There will be a HazMat fee per item when shipping a dangerous goods. The HazMat fee will be charged to your UPS/DHL/FedEx collect account or added to the invoice unless the package is shipped via Ground service. Ship by air in Excepted Quantity (each bottle), which is up to 1g/1mL for class 6.1 packing group I or II, and up to 25g/25ml for all other HazMat items.

1 (300 mg, 0.45 mmol, 1 equiv) and l-(3-aminopropyl)-2-pipecoline (170 mg, 0.9 mmol, 2 equiv) were dissolved in ACN (2 mL), and DIEA (87 iL, 0.67 mmol, 1.5 equiv) was added. The reaction mixture was heated at 80 C for 40 minutes, and the resulting blue mixture was neutralized with 0.1 N HCl and concentrated under vacuum. The blue mixture was dissolved in DCM under N2 atmosphere, and treated with excess DIEA (700 iL, 5.39 mmol, 12 equiv) and methyl 4- (chloroformyl)butyrate (110 μ, 0.67 mmol, 1.5 equiv) at 0 C for 15 minutes. The resulting green product 2 was washed with 0.1 N HCl and brine, concentrated under vacuum, and used without further purification.
